Farmington (Maine)

Farmington is a city in Franklin County, Maine , USA . The administrative center of the district. According to the 2010 US Census , the city had a population of 7,760.

History

Before the arrival of Europeans, the territory of the district was inhabited by representatives of the Indian tribe Abenaki [1] . The settlement, from which the city later grew, was founded on February 1, 1794 on the territory of the Sandy River Plantation [2] . In 1838, Farmington received the status of the administrative center of the newly formed Franklin County. In 1859, the terminal station of the Androscoggin Railway ( Androscoggin Railroad ) was built in the city [1] . In 1879, the Sandy River and Rangeley Lakes Railroad section of the Sandy River –Lane Railroad was laid through the city.

Geography

The city is located in the southwestern part of the state, on the banks of the Sandy River River (left tributary of the Kennebeck River ), approximately 40 kilometers northwest of Augusta , the state’s administrative center. The absolute height is 121 meters above sea ​​level [3] .
According to the US Census Bureau , the city’s territory is 144.57 km², of which 144.18 km² is land and 0.39 km² (i.e. 0.27%) on the water surface.

Climate

Farmington has a humid continental climate ( Dfb in the Köppen climate classification ), with frosty, snowy winters and warm summers. The average annual rainfall is 1185.1 mm.

Demographics

According to the 2010 census , 7,760 people lived in Farmington (3,515 men and 4,245 women), 1,597 families, 3,072 households, and 3,441 housing units. The average population density was about 53.82 people per square kilometer [5] .
According to the census, the racial makeup of the city was as follows: 96.89% are white , 0.26% are African Americans , 0.41% are Native Americans, 0.35% are Asians , 0.08% are residents of Hawaii or Oceania, 0.28% are representatives of other races, 1.73% are two or more races. The number of Hispanic residents of any race was 1.29% [5] .
Of 3559 households, 23.1% raised children under the age of 18, 38.2% were married couples, in 9.9% of families women lived without husbands, in 3.9% of families men lived without wives , 48% did not have a family. 34.1% of the total number of families at the time of the census lived independently, while 13% were single elderly people aged 65 years and older. The average household size was 2.17 people, and the average family size was 2.75 people [5] .
The population of the city by age range according to the 2010 census was as follows: 16% - residents under 18 years old, 27.2% - between 18 and 24 years old, 18.3% - from 25 to 44 years old, 23.3% - from 45 to 64 years old and 15.5% - at the age of 65 years and older. The average age of residents was 32.1 years.
